K<sub>3,3</sub> is a [[toroidal graph]], which means it can be embedded without crossings on a [[torus]], a surface of genus one,{{r|harary}} and that versions of the puzzle in which the cottages and companies are drawn on a [[coffee mug]] or other such surface instead of a flat plane can be solved.{{r|parker}} Similarly, if the puzzle is presented on a sheet of papera transparent material, it may be solved after twisting and gluing the papersheet to form a [[Möbius strip]].{{r|larsen}}
 
Another way of changing the rules of the puzzle that would make it solvable, suggested by Dudeney, is to allow utility lines to pass through the cottages or utilities.{{r|dud17}}
